gma500: Fix incorrect SR issue when disabling CRTC already in disabled state

Currently when trying to call the DPMS off again for one CRTC with DPMS off,
it will firstly disable the SR and can't enable it again because of the
incorrect check/logic. In such case the self refresh is still disabled
although one CRTC pipe is active. This is wrong.
